Impedir uso de libro segun una fecha

16/01/2005 - 22:25 por Rene Palacios | Informe spam
Hola a todos espero me ayuden, como se puede hacer para impedir q un libro se
abra en una determinada fecha q le ponga yo, es posible ? y de ser asi en
donde se podria dicho codigo en un modulo o thisworkbook?

Preguntas similare

Leer las respuestas

#11 Daniel
17/01/2005 - 19:23 | Informe spam
Hey Rene ya probe la macro y si funciona bien pero tiene razon Carlos fijate
en el formato de fecha si asi insistes en botar tu pc me pasas la voz nomas
para mi colegio
Respuesta Responder a este mensaje
#12 KL
17/01/2005 - 19:35 | Informe spam
Hola chicos,

Tambien probad introduciendo la fecha en el siguiente formato y ojo creo q
ya es 17/01/2005 en todas partes.

Saludos,
KL

Private Sub Workbook_Open()
If Date = #16/01/2005# Then
ThisWorkbook.Close
End If
End Sub

"Manuel Romero" @hotmail.com> wrote in message
news:OqdzqJM$
Cambia la comparacion, el valor de fecha como cadena depende de la
configuracion regional, mejor usa DateSerial

If Date=DateSerial(2005,1,16) Then

Lo otro, que ya te comentaron, es que si el libro se abre sin macros, no
sirve de nada

"Rene Palacios" escribió en el
mensaje news:
Hola Carlos y Manuel

He vuelto aprobar la macro varias veces y si le doy q trabaje con macros
pero insisto no me funciona el libro se abre igual...

Private Sub Workbook_Open()
If Date = "16/01/2005" Then
ThisWorkbook.Close
End If
End Sub


Carlos esta codigo de macro donde iria, debajo del codigo q me mando




Woorbook_BeforeClose(Cancel as Boolean)
dim h as worksheet
For each h in Thisworkbook.worksheets
if h.name<>"MACROS" then
h.Visible=xlSheetHidden
end fi
next
End sub

Espero me puedan ayudar este codigo el primero esta en Thisworkbook no se


q
pasa?




Respuesta Responder a este mensaje
#13 Manuel Romero
17/01/2005 - 19:38 | Informe spam
Cambia la comparacion, el valor de fecha como cadena depende de la
configuracion regional, mejor usa DateSerial

If Date=DateSerial(2005,1,16) Then

Lo otro, que ya te comentaron, es que si el libro se abre sin macros, no
sirve de nada

"Rene Palacios" escribió en el
mensaje news:
Hola Carlos y Manuel

He vuelto aprobar la macro varias veces y si le doy q trabaje con macros
pero insisto no me funciona el libro se abre igual...

Private Sub Workbook_Open()
If Date = "16/01/2005" Then
ThisWorkbook.Close
End If
End Sub


Carlos esta codigo de macro donde iria, debajo del codigo q me mando




Woorbook_BeforeClose(Cancel as Boolean)
dim h as worksheet
For each h in Thisworkbook.worksheets
if h.name<>"MACROS" then
h.Visible=xlSheetHidden
end fi
next
End sub

Espero me puedan ayudar este codigo el primero esta en Thisworkbook no se


q
pasa?
Respuesta Responder a este mensaje
#14 Daniel Padilla Cañamero
17/01/2005 - 20:41 | Informe spam
Lo unico malo es q si se desabilita las macros al abrir el libro ya no
funciona, lo q ya no le veo la gracia, hay una manera de impedir eso sin
poner el nivel de macro en bajo porq eso seria un suicidio
Respuesta Responder a este mensaje
#15 Carlos Durán Urenda
17/01/2005 - 20:42 | Informe spam
eso ya lo respondi en este hilo,
Firmando digitalmente tu codigo ;-)


"Daniel Padilla Cañamero"
escribió en el mensaje
news:
Lo unico malo es q si se desabilita las macros al abrir el libro ya no
funciona, lo q ya no le veo la gracia, hay una manera de impedir eso sin
poner el nivel de macro en bajo porq eso seria un suicidio


Respuesta Responder a este mensaje
Ads by Google
Help Hacer una preguntaSiguiente AnteriorRespuesta Tengo una respuesta
Search Busqueda sugerida